Senior Full-Stack Developer

Solaborate
E skaduar

We are looking for a Senior Full-Stack Developer responsible for managing the interchange of data between the server and the users. Your primary focus will be the development of all server-side logic, definition, and maintenance of the central database, and ensuring high performance and responsiveness to requests from the front-end. You will also be responsible for integrating the front-end elements built by your co-workers into the application. Therefore, a basic understanding of front-end technologies is necessary as well.

Requirements:
• An expert understanding of JavaScript, familiarity with ES6+ features
• Knowledge of Node.js and node frameworks such as Express etc.
• Understanding of asynchronous programming
• Extensive use of APIs and understanding of HTTP and REST architecture
• Experience with NoSQL - Redis, MongoDB
• Expert understanding of code versioning tools, such as Git.
• Understanding fundamental design principles behind a scalable application
• Hands-on experience working on Node.js development tools like npm, gulp, etc.
• Strong understanding of systems using real-time interactions (WebSockets, long-polling, etc.)
• Knowledge of front-end technologies such as VUE.JS, React
• Knowledge of WebRTC, Socket.io it’s a plus.

Responsibilities:
• Integration of user-facing elements developed by front-end developers with server-side logic
• Writing reusable, testable, and efficient code
• Design and implementation of low-latency, high-availability, and performant applications
• Implementation of security and data protection
• Integration of data storage solutions (may include databases, key-value stores, blob stores, etc.)
• Collaborate with Product Owners and Quality Assurance team to define, size and implement user stories
• Create system design artifacts and other technical documentation, as required

Benefits:
We are located at the center of Pristina
Work Schedule: 9:00AM - 5:00PM
Working Days: Mon-Fri
Competitive Salary
Great Health Insurance Plan
We offer a fast-paced environment that is perfect for people who love seeing their work make a big difference in a large audience.
Work with a great experienced team and grow together.
Possibility to travel across the world.

More info about HELLO products:
https://www.solaborate.com/hello2

Start Date: ASAP
Type: Full-time

If you possess the required attitude, skills, and experience, seize the opportunity to become one of us and apply today! Please apply via careers@solaborate.com by sending your Curriculum Vitae (in English) and the Job-Title as Subject.

Solaborate LLC is an Equal Opportunity Employer. All applications will be treated with the strictest confidence. Only short-listed candidates will be notified.

 

Shpallja ka skaduar